Instant Nail Effect


So here it is! I had been drooling over this nail paint for a few weeks before I decided to go ahead and get it.The Instant Nail Effect from Barry M gives a cracked type of look to the nail, which in theory sounds pretty cool, right?
 I really wanted it because it was something new and unusual. I liked it the first few times I tried it, but there are a few things I don`t like as well.



First of all, if you take too much product on the nails, it wound "crack" properly and it will just look like a black square on your nail.
If you put too little product on your nails, the nail effect "cracks" into tiny, tiny bits which I don`t think looks very good.

Another thing I also really don`t like is that sometimes when applying the nail effect, it makes the nail polish I have underneath disappear a little, like you can see on the picture below.  


I think that for me, this turned out to more of a novelty nail varnish, but the novelty effect didn`t last very long. It`s fun to wear when you want to do something different with your nails and if your not good at nail art. I see other brands are coming out with this type of "cracking" effect nail varnish, so I might buy some other colors from other brands just to compare.
I think that one of the reasons that I wanted to buy this product in the first place was that it was new and unusual and I didn`t know anyone else who had this kind of product, but now that other brands are coming out with the same thing, it doesn`t appeal to me as much anymore.

Barry M blush - Strawberry

A few weeks ago I saw that Barry M had a few new blushers, so I decided to buy the one that most appealed to me, which just happened to be no 3/Strawberry.
The color is an orangy hot pink type color. It might look a bit scary because it is quite a vibrant color and it is actually very pigmented as well, so I wasn`t sure if I really liked it at first.
You only need a little bit because a little goes a long way with this blush and the more you blend it, the better it looks!
The texture is good. It`s not chalky at all, so it won`t crumble when you use it.

In this picture I am using the blush. I only used a little bit and blended it quite well so the color wouldn`t be too bright.

I think this might actually be my new favorite blush at the moment.
